Observação
O acesso a essa página exige autorização. Você pode tentar entrar ou alterar diretórios.
O acesso a essa página exige autorização. Você pode tentar alterar os diretórios.
Coleção AccessObjectProperties contém todos os objetos AccessObjectProperty personalizados de uma instância específica de um objeto. Esses objetos AccessObjectProperty (que geralmente são denominados apenas propriedades) caracterizar exclusivamente essa instância do objeto.
Comentários
Use a coleção AccessObjectProperties no Visual Basic ou em uma expressão para se referir às propriedades do objeto AccessObject, CodeProject ou CurrentProject. Por exemplo, você pode enumerar a coleção AccessObjectProperties para definir ou retornar os valores das propriedades de um relatório individual.
Observação
A coleção AccessObjectProperties não está acessível para objetos derivados do objeto CurrentData (por exemplo, CurrentData.AllTables! Tabela1). Para objetos derivados dessa maneira, você só pode acessar as suas propriedades internas através de chamadas diretas para a propriedade desejada (por exemplo, CurrentData.AllTables!Tabela1.Name).
Para adicionar uma propriedade definida pelo usuário a uma instância existente de um objeto, defina as suas características e adicioná-lo à coleção com o método Add. Referência a um objeto AccessObjectProperty definida pelo usuário que ainda não acrescentado a uma coleção AccessObjectProperties causará um erro, o que ocorrerá um objeto AccessObjectProperty de definidas pelo usuário a uma coleção AccessObjectProperties contendo um objeto AccessObjectProperty do mesmo nome.
Utilize o método Remove para remover propriedades definidas pelo utilizador da coleção AccessObjectProperties .
Observação
[!OBSERVAçãO] Um objeto de AccessObjectProperty interno ou definido pelo usuário é associado apenas à instância específica de um objeto. A propriedade não está definida para todas as instâncias de objetos do tipo selecionado.
Para fazer referência a um objeto AccessObjectProperty incorporado ou definido pelo utilizador numa coleção pelo respetivo número ordinal ou pela respetiva definição de propriedade Nome , utilize qualquer um dos seguintes formulários de sintaxe.
CurrentProject.AllForms("Form1").Properties(0)
CurrentProject.AllForms("Form1").Properties("name")
CurrentProject.AllForms("Form1").Properties![name]
Com os mesmos formulários de sintaxe, também pode consultar a propriedade Valor de um objeto AccessObjectProperty . O contexto da referência determinará se está a referir-se ao objeto AccessObjectProperty propriamente dito ou à propriedade Value do objeto AccessObjectProperty .
Observação
As propriedades na coleção AccessObjectProperties não são armazenadas e podem ser perdidas quando o objeto ao qual estão associados é dada entrada ou saída através do suplemento Controlo de Código Fonte.
Métodos
Propriedades
Confira também
Suporte e comentários
Tem dúvidas ou quer enviar comentários sobre o VBA para Office ou sobre esta documentação? Confira Suporte e comentários sobre o VBA para Office a fim de obter orientação sobre as maneiras pelas quais você pode receber suporte e fornecer comentários.